标签:rmi 策略 eject host 开启 tcp perm 插件 添加节点
Visual GC提示"不受此JVM支持“,如果想使用这个插件,就需要配置jstatd连接方式,下面来看jstatd的配置;
1.配置安全策略
文件路径$JAVA_HOME/jre/lib/security/java.policy
在文件末位的 }; 前添加
permission java.security.AllPermission;
2.启动jstatd
注意:是在被监控机器启动
cd $JAVA_HOME/bin
./jstatd -J-Djava.security.policy=all.policy &
启动后会开启注册端口1099和一个随机的连接端口,注册端口也可通过-p参数指定,如./jstatd -J-Djava.security.policy=all.policy -p 10003 &
3.设置防火墙
除了把1099添加到防火墙规则外,还需要找到另外一个随机端口,也加入到规则中
执行
netstat -anp | grep *jstatd
vi /etc/sysconfig/iptables
在-A INPUT -j REJECT --reject-with icmp-host-prohibited前加入
-A INPUT -p tcp -m state --state NEW -m tcp --dport 1009 -j ACCEPT
4.测试
启动VisualVM,因为在配置JMX时已经添加过服务器节点,如果配置正确,通常VisualVM会自动检测到jstatd连接并添加节点
如果没有自动添加,可以检查端口是否能连通并尝试手动添加连接
Visual GC提示"不受此JVM支持“解决方案(配置jstatd)
标签:rmi 策略 eject host 开启 tcp perm 插件 添加节点
原文地址:http://www.cnblogs.com/liu-ke/p/7411484.html